The Kansas City National Security Campus (KCNSC), managed and operated by Honeywell Federal Manufacturing & Technologies, is a premier advanced manufacturing facility that supports the safety, security, reliability and effectiveness of our nation's nuclear deterrent. With nearly 7,000 employees combined in Kansas City, Missouri, and Albuquerque, New Mexico, KCNSC protects our nation and allies by producing trusted national security products and services for the U.S. Department of Energy's National Nuclear Security Administration.

Summary

Responsible for assisting management with organizational initiatives that include devising, developing maintaining changes to equipment, components, and systems.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Develops, prototypes, and tests new products, special instruments, and unique equipment to ensure equipment meets specific customer order requirements.  
  • Analyzes design requirements and test results, makes recommendations for and initiates design improvements.  
  • Performs technical evaluations of in-process, acceptance and inspection equipment located in the field. Includes programming equipment to different simulations in outdoor environments and the mechanical support, testing/operation of special equipment in field support activities.  
  • Support consists of both technical bench and field set-up / deployment / retrieval and repairs with travel to remote site areas as required. 
  • Installs and integrates instruments and equipment into complex systems, participates in the design and execution of system wide testing and debugging.  
  • Compiles cost estimates and delivery quotations, monitors performance, and prepares reports, statistics, and recommendations for management review.  
  • Plans and performs testing and development and uses scientific methods to address and resolve technical problems.  
  • Determines acceptability of products and materials in conjunction with design agency, quality, and other affected organizations.  
  • Develops intelligent electronic schematics on CAD systems and incorporates design in PCB. Performs moderate to complex special technical assignments requiring significant data gathering, analysis and systems integration.  
  • Performs other technical duties as required in support of Management/Engineering activities.

We are required by the Department of Energy (DOE) to conduct a pre-employment drug test and background review, including checks of references, credit, law enforcement records and employment/education history. Applicants must be able to obtain and maintain a DOE Q-level security clearance, which requires U.S. citizenship. Dual citizenship may affect clearance eligibility.

 

All employment offers are contingent on a federal background investigation. Substance abuse, illegal drug use, falsified information, criminal activity, serious misconduct or other indicators of untrustworthiness may result in denial or loss of clearance and termination of employment.

National Nuclear Security Administration (NNSA) Requirements for MedPEDs
If you have a medical portable electronic device (MedPED) — such as a pacemaker, defibrillator, drug‑releasing pump, hearing aids or diagnostic equipment used to measure or monitor body functions — you may be required to meet NNSA security requirements if employed by us.
